Output dd59b5bdff84125566a16ace884fd2aba68d99afeef04b7e0b66cb7c6aa7d084:0

value
6639236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cebadcd1a6426fd45fc9fe6d630b7fe70446bb29 OP_EQUAL
address
3LY6yVxWb8YdyJmub29QASMKTxHYKFUYqV
transaction
dd59b5bdff84125566a16ace884fd2aba68d99afeef04b7e0b66cb7c6aa7d084
confirmations
49250
spent
true